Information for those planning to visit Norway
IF you are not a Norwegian or EU citizen and are planning to visit to work, volunteer or study, YOU WILL NEED THE CORRECT VISA / AU PAIR PERMIT (if applicable). To find out more information you need to contact the embassy in your home country BEFORE travelling.
